A wintry and ghoulish Frey & McGray poem for fans of Detective 'Nine-Nails' McGray and his erstwhile English sidekick, Inspector Ian Frey, in celebration of the pair's 5th anniversary...

Features a sample of The Dance of the Serpent.

Oscar de Muriel

Oscar de Muriel was born in Mexico City where he began writing stories aged seven, and later came to the UK to complete a PhD in Chemistry. Whilst working as a translator and playing the violin, the idea for a spooky whodunnit series came to him and Nine-Nails McGray was born. Oscar has now written four Frey and McGray titles and splits his time between Manchester and Mexico City.
